Really cool Dual Pro with lolly pop tuners. Comes with a custom wood case. I believe this guitar was re-finished at some point in it's history, but it was done very well and is quite attractive. $775 plus $125 for shipping boxing and insurance.
The top neck (the one that is further away from the player) is reading 6.77 K ohms and the one closest to the player is 10.68 k ohms. Both have a clean sound (no buzzing etc) and good volume. The top pickup has a deeper sound and the bottom neck has a brighter sound.

Cody Farwell wrote: |
Looks nice. Do you know the exact year? I don't think I've seen one with the 40's fretboards and the trapezoid pickups. |
My guess is it was made in late '49, early '50. Mot Dual Pros with the roman numeral fret markers have boxcar pickups, but there was a bit of crossover. Remember--Leo NEVER wasted anything! _________________ Remington Steelmaster S8 w/ custom Steeltronics pickup. Vox MV-50 amplifier + an 1940's Oahu cab w/ 8" American Vintage speaker. J.
